The Sebastian - Vail Hotel
39.64257, -106.37809Situated just steps from ski slopes, The Sebastian - Vail Hotel is just 11 minutes' stroll from Colorado Snowsports Museum and Hall of Fame and boasts 4 hot tubs. Located within arm's reach of Betty Ford Alpine Gardens, the comfortable 5-star hotel offers a restaurant, and comforts such as a cash machine and elevator.
Location
The Vail hotel is nestled next to the entertainment district of Vail and 0.3 miles from Ford Park. The luxury Sebastian in the Vail Village district of Vail is located approximately 25 minutes by foot from Little Eagle -15. The property is situated relatively close to Vail Ski Resort, and Vail Transportation Center bus station lies 0.4 miles away.
The Sebastian - Vail Hotel is merely 10 minutes by foot from Gondola One cable car station.
Rooms
Some of the 100 smoke-free rooms at the hotel are furnished with a writing desk, and appointed with a mini-refrigerator, coffee and tea making facilities. For your safety, these cozy rooms are appointed with a safe box. The private bathrooms are equipped with a shower cap and towels. Also, the rooms with views of valley are provided for guests' comfort.

Leisure & Business
A gym and spa therapy are offered at the Vail accommodation for an extra charge. The boutique Sebastian Vail includes a fitness suite, a full-service spa and a spa salon to ensure guests maximum relaxation. Additionally, staying at the non-smoking hotel, active guests can enjoy a golf course on site. Wellness options at this Vail hotel include a hot tub and a sauna, and such beauty treatments as a massage treatment. Business travelers are welcome to use a meeting room offered on site.
